In light of the mass shooting in Maine recently, host Adrienne Stein talks with psychiatrist Dr. Jeffery Barkin about age-appropriate ways to speak with our children about tragedy. This is more than how to talk to our children after what happened in Lewiston - this is about how to connect with children anywhere when faced with having difficult conversations about experiences we as parents wish we could protect them from forever.  Dr. Barkin explains the most important thing we can do during these difficult conversations, how we can ease anxiety for both us as parents and our kids, plus what we can do for our own mental health.
